2. Virtual Staging AI: $15 Instead of $2,000 Per Room

Virtual Staging AI takes a photo of an empty room and adds photorealistic furniture, decor, and lighting — all in the style you choose. The difference from traditional virtual staging services: AI staging takes 30 seconds per photo and costs $15/image, vs. $50-100/image for manual virtual staging and $2,000+/room for physical staging. The quality is now indistinguishable from manual virtual staging for most room types.

When to use which: AI staging for standard rooms (living rooms, bedrooms, dining rooms). Manual virtual staging for challenging spaces (rooms with unusual architecture, very small rooms, rooms with odd angles). Physical staging for luxury listings ($1M+) where buyers expect to see real furniture and the commission justifies the cost.

3. AI Photography Enhancement: The Third Tool You Didn't Know You Needed

Between Jasper for writing and Virtual Staging for empty rooms, there's a third AI tool that real estate agents are adopting rapidly: AI photo enhancement. Tools like Apply Design AI and BoxBrownie can take your smartphone photos and: replace overcast skies with blue ones, remove cars from driveways, declutter countertops, add virtual twilight lighting to exterior shots, and correct lens distortion from wide-angle shots. Cost: $1-5 per photo. Impact: listings with professionally enhanced photos get 61% more views than listings with raw smartphone photos (Zillow data).
